RM- any great trout rivers close by? Are you a fly fisherman?
Any great trout rivers close by? Yup, the Gallatin, the Madison, the Boulder and the Yellowstone. I fly fish, but more often it is spin fishing. The biggest Brown I ever landed - longer than my arm (never took him out of the water) was caught in the East Gallatin about 5 miles from my house on a #14 Grizzly Adams dry fly. The so called Lower Madison, from the dam in Ennis to the headwaters of the Missouri is perhaps the most prolific trout waters in the lower 48 with a trout census of several thousand a mile. Travel up to a couple of hours and some other fab waters available : Ruby, North Fork of The Madison, and others.
